Many city hostels for women have been found running without proper permissions from concerned depts. This brings the safety of the women staying in them, on the line.

Over 104 were found to be running without proper licenses from the District Women and Child Development Agency (DWCDA) officials.

DWCDA officials are turning a blind eye to the issue while only five hostels run with the proper licensing.

The DWCDA project director, K Krishna Kumari said that she would take strict action against women and girl hostel organizers who fail to present proper permissions from the DWCDA to run hostels.

Deputy Commissioner of Police for Law and Order, G Pala Raju said that police officials would conduct inspections at women and girl hostels in the city from next week .

He mentioned that the city police officials conducted surprise inspections in 38 women and girl hostels in the city between April 12 to 16 to check the implementation of rules and regulations of hostels norms including security, peaceful atmosphere at the hostels.

He said that women hostel management must appoint women warden and a women security guard while the hostel premises is surveiled through CCTV. “Hostel management must maintain the register regarding in and out time of women and girls in hostel,” he added.

He mentioned that the Mahila Mitra members were creating awareness over women and girl safety to the hostel organisers in the city and hostels management needed to register their organisations at the concerned offices to run hostels.
